Wenjing Liao
About
Wenjing Liao has authored 39 papers that have received a total of 582 indexed citations.
This includes 15 papers in Computer Vision and Pattern Recognition, 12 papers in Computational Mechanics and 8 papers in Artificial Intelligence. The topics of these papers are Sparse and Compressive Sensing Techniques (11 papers), Neural Networks and Applications (6 papers) and Model Reduction and Neural Networks (6 papers). Wenjing Liao is often cited by papers focused on Sparse and Compressive Sensing Techniques (11 papers), Neural Networks and Applications (6 papers) and Model Reduction and Neural Networks (6 papers) and collaborates with scholars based in United States, China and Hong Kong. Wenjing Liao's co-authors include Albert Fannjiang, Weilin Li, Sung Ha Kang, Mauro Maggioni and Haoming Jiang and has published in prestigious journals such as Journal of Computational Physics, IEEE Transactions on Information Theory and IEEE Transactions on Signal Processing.
